Chapter 7 - Integration - 7.1 Antiderivatives - 7.1 Exercises - Page 367: 61

Answer

$a\ln x-bx+C$

Work Step by Step

$$\int \frac{g(x)}{x} dx$$ Substitute $g(x)=a-bx$: $$\begin{align*} \int \frac{g(x)}{x} dx&=\int \frac{a-bx}{x} dx\\ &=\int \left(\frac{a}{x}-b\right) dx\\ &=a\ln x-bx+C. \end{align*}$$
